Hi Bruno, It seems useful to me to have a distinct shorthand way to refer to the 2G line vs. the 4G line. Since "bar" already refers to the 4G line, using "mini-bar" to refer to the 2G line appeals to me. As regards to a "name" for the 2G-4G area, "DEADZONE" is something I came up with back in 2004 for use by z/XDC. But now the dead zone isn't so dead anymore, is it... Since 2G-32G is now reserved for use by JAVA, maybe the "JAVAHUTT"??? ("Jabba_the_Hutt" is probably a bit too long.)
